Koolhaus Games releases free version of iMP: Surf the Music
Koolhaus Games Inc. today released a free version of their popular music game iMP: Surf the Music for iPhone and iPod Touch. Players generate their own funky soundtracks by gathering bits of funk to trigger music loops and audio accents. Different versions of the soundtrack can be created.
